General Hamilton thanks the Gordons for their attack after the battle of Doornkop. Ian Hamilton was an former officer of the regiment and later became their Colonel (1914-1939). They certainly deserved his thanks after he had asked them to face almost certain death with a frontal assault on Boer trenches. The horizontal lines beyond the hills are flames from the dry grass that had been set on fire to blacken the landscape. |
